Football Rumours on Friday 14th February 2020
2020-02-14 09:10:26



TRANSFER RUMOURS

  • Tottenham Hotspur are considering a move for Norwich City's £50m-rated 22-year-old English defender Ben Godfrey.
    (Daily Express)


  • Spurs are also interested in the Canaries' England Under-21 right-back Max Aarons.
    (Daily Express)


  • Tottenham are losing patience with 26-year-old Eric Dier because the England midfielder is stalling on a new contract.
    (Daily Mail)


  • Manchester United have been given approval to sign Lyon's French striker Moussa Dembele, 23, in a £60m deal.
    (Daily Star)


  • Chelsea have agreed a deal to sign Ajax's Hakim Ziyech at the end of the season for £33.3m.
    (Sky Sports)


  • Chelsea have also been encouraged in their pursuit of Dembele as Lyon president Jean-Michel Aulas admitted they will "sell the players who want to leave".
    (Daily Mail)


  • Paris St-Germain are set to offer France striker Kylian Mbappe a £41m-a-year contract to avoid losing the 21-year-old to Real Madrid in 2021.
    (Daily Mirror)


  • PSG are planning a summer approach for Manchester United's 22-year-old English goalkeeper Dean Henderson, who is on loan at Sheffield United.
    (Daily Mail)


  • Real Madrid are willing to pay Inter Milan the 120m euros needed to release Argentine striker Lautaro Martinez, 22, from his contract.
    (TyC Sports)




MANAGEMENT STUFF
  • Manager Pep Guardiola has claimed Manchester City could sack him if they fail to beat Real Madrid in the Champions League.
    (Guardian)


  • Newcastle United manager Steve Bruce will push for a new contract for English striker Andy Carroll, despite the 31-year-old making only four Premier League starts since rejoining the Magpies last summer.
    (Northern Echo)


  • Wigan boss Paul Cook has been charged with using abusive language and improper conduct, the Football Association has announced.
    (Sky Sports)


  • Nuno Espirito Santo has held no talks with Wolves over a new deal. The Molineux boss, a huge favourite with fans, is out of contract in 15 months.
    (Sun)


  • Joey Barton hit with an FA charge after Fleetwood manager is sent off for the SECOND time this season.
    (Daily Mail)




OTHER STUFF
  • Tottenham are planning to celebrate all-time record goalscorer Jimmy Greaves' 80th birthday before their Champions League match against RB Leipzig next week.
    (London Evening Standard)


  • Potential Manchester United buyers are reportedly being put off by the astronomical cost of repairs needed at the club's creaking Old Trafford ground.
    (Daily Mirror)


  • Millwall have held "positive" talks with Lewisham Council over plans to redevelop their stadium.
    (Sky Sports)


  • Bobby Madley is returning to professional refereeing in England after 18 months away from the game in this country.
    (Sky Sports)


  • Premier League referees Andy Madley and David Coote have failed FIFA fitness tests in an embarrassing blow to Mike Riley. Madley and Coote were the only referees put forward by the Professional Game Match Officials Board (PGMOL) to become members of the FIFA international list.
    (Daily Mirror)
